Explore the groundbreaking Einstein Telescope project in this informative 17-minute conference talk presented by Edward Porter from APC/CNRS at the Meeting of the National Research Group on Gravitational Waves. Delve into the cutting-edge technology and scientific advancements behind this next-generation gravitational wave detector. Gain insights into how the Einstein Telescope aims to revolutionize our understanding of the universe by detecting gravitational waves with unprecedented sensitivity. Learn about the project's goals, design challenges, and potential scientific discoveries that could reshape our knowledge of astrophysics and cosmology.
